Oman Air launches new ticketing option

Oman Air recently announced its intent to roll out a new multi-segment ticket option, named Oman Air Rahal.
The product offers substantial savings on multiple business class or economy class flights between Muscat and destinations across the GCC, as well as Tehran. Destinations covered by Oman Air Rahal include Abu Dhabi, Bahrain, Dammam, Doha, Dubai, Kuwait, Muscat, Riyadh and Tehran.
Oman Air Rahal is available for booking four return flights to any one of the above-named destinations, with only the first flight being confirmed at time of purchase. Timing of remaining flights can be decided at a later time, but all flights must be taken within 12 months of purchase.
Subsequently, members of the airline’s Sindbad frequent flyers programme can also accrue Sindbad Miles on all flights they take using an Oman Air Rahal ticket.
